Ingredients You’ll Need

This Oven Baked Salmon Recipe comes together with simple ingredients that you likely already have on hand, yet each plays a crucial role in creating layers of flavor, texture, and color. From olive oil that keeps the salmon moist to fresh lemon that adds brightness, every element is essential for a mouthwatering result.

  • 4 Salmon Filets (6-ounce each, skin on or off): Choose fresh, quality salmon for the best taste and texture.
  • 2 Tablespoons Olive Oil (divided): Adds richness and helps the seasonings adhere to the fish.
  • 1 Teaspoon Salt: Enhances the natural flavors of the salmon.
  • 1/2 Teaspoon Black Pepper: Provides subtle heat and depth without overpowering.
  • 2 Garlic Cloves (minced): Infuses a savory aroma and bold flavor that complements the fish beautifully.
  • 1 Teaspoon Italian Seasoning: A fragrant mix of herbs that adds complexity.
  • 1 Tablespoon Lemon Juice: Brightens the dish with fresh acidity.
  • 4 Lemon Slices: For garnish and an extra touch of citrus aroma as they bake on top.

How to Make Oven Baked Salmon Recipe

Step 1: Preheat and Prepare

Begin by preheating your oven to 425°F (220°C), which is the perfect temperature to get that tender salmon with a slightly crisp exterior.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or foil to make cleanup a breeze.

Step 2: Season the Salmon

Pat your salmon filets dry with a paper towel—that little step ensures the olive oil and seasonings stick better. Drizzle 1 tablespoon of olive oil over the salmon and season each piece generously with salt and pepper, creating a simple but flavorful base.

Step 3: Mix the Aromatic Olive Oil

In a small bowl, combine the remaining olive oil, minced garlic, Italian seasoning, and lemon juice. Whisked together, this mixture will coat the filets with a vibrant, herbaceous flavor that truly elevates the dish.

Step 4: Arrange and Dress the Salmon

Place the filets skin-side down on your prepared baking sheet. Spoon the seasoned olive oil mixture evenly over the top of each filet, making sure every bite will be infused with those wonderful flavors.

Step 5: Add Lemon Slices

Top each filet with a thin lemon slice. As the salmon bakes, the lemon will release subtle citrusy steam, enhancing the natural richness of the fish.

Step 6: Bake to Perfection

Pop the salmon into the oven and bake for 12 to 15 minutes. The exact time depends on the thickness of your filets, but you’re aiming for salmon that flakes easily with a fork and has that gorgeous, juicy pink interior.

Step 7: Rest and Serve

Once baked, allow the salmon to rest a few minutes out of the oven. This helps lock in juices, so every bite is silky and tender. Now you’re ready to enjoy your delicious Oven Baked Salmon Recipe!

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

After the salmon has cooled to room temperature, store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Properly stored, cooked salmon keeps well for up to 3 days, making it a great option for quick lunches or dinners later in the week.

Freezing

If you have more leftovers than you can eat within a few days, you can freeze cooked salmon. Wrap the filets tightly with pl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e bag or container. For best quality, consume frozen salmon within 2 months and th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.

Reheating

To reheat your salmon without drying it out, gently warm it in the oven at 275°F (135°C) for 10-15 minutes or until heated through. You can also microwave it on a low setting, covered loosely with a microwave-safe lid, checking frequently to avoid overcooking.

FAQs

Can I use frozen salmon for this Oven Baked Salmon Recipe?

Absolutely! Just be sure to thaw it completely in the refrigerator overnight before seasoning and baking to ensure even cooking.

Do I need to skin the salmon before baking?

Whether the skin stays on or off is totally up to you. The skin helps keep the salmon moist while baking and can easily be removed before eating if you prefer.

How can I tell when the salmon is fully cooked?

The salmon should flake easily with a fork and have an opaque pink color inside, not translucent. Cooking times vary slightly depending on thickness.

Can I substitute the Italian seasoning with other herbs?

Yes! Fresh or dried dill, thyme, or rosemary all work wonderfully if you want to switch up the flavor profile.
